A teenage girl is dead and two others are in hospital after being hit by a motorcycle in Surrey.

The three Princess Margaret Secondary School students were hit in the intersection of 128th Street and 68th Avenue at around 11.30 a.m. Wednesday, Surrey RCMP said.

UPDATE: The teenage girl killed in a Surrey motorcycle accident has been identified as Amarpreet Sivia, CTV News reported.

Two of the girls were taken to hospital by air ambulance, where one subsequently died. The third teen and the driver of the motorcycle, described as a young male by police, were taken to a Surrey area hospital with serious injuries.

RCMP Cpl. Bert Paquet was not able to tell The Huffington Post B.C. the names or ages of those involved.
